Abstract

An electric power converter includes a semiconductor module, a cooler, and a pair of direct current bus bars. The direct current bus bars are connected to the semiconductor. The direct current bus bars serve as current paths between the direct current power supply and the switching element. The cooler is made of metal, and is electrically connected to ground. A proximal bypass capacitor is formed close to the switching element by a heat radiating plate integrated with the semiconductor module, the cooler, and an insulating layer interposed between them. The electric power converter further includes a pair of distal bypass capacitors, each of which has a larger capacitance than the proximal bypass capacitor has, and has a current path to the switching element of which a length is longer than a current path to the switching element from the proximal bypass capacitor.
